技术文摘
Redis集群具备哪些特性
2025-01-14 23:23:07 小编
Redis集群具备哪些特性
在当今数字化快速发展的时代,Redis集群作为一种强大的分布式内存数据存储解决方案,正被广泛应用于各种领域。那么,Redis集群究竟具备哪些特性呢?
Redis集群拥有高可扩展性。随着业务量的不断增长,数据量和访问量也会急剧上升。Redis集群能够轻松应对这种变化,通过增加节点的方式,线性扩展系统的存储容量和处理能力,满足日益增长的业务需求。这使得企业无需担心随着规模扩大而出现性能瓶颈。
它具备强大的容错能力。在Redis集群中,即使部分节点出现故障,系统依然能够正常运行。通过内置的复制和故障转移机制,当某个主节点发生故障时,对应的从节点能够迅速晋升为主节点,接管其工作,确保数据的可用性和服务的连续性,极大地减少了因硬件或软件故障带来的影响。
数据分布的均匀性也是Redis集群的重要特性之一。它采用哈希槽的方式将数据均匀分布在各个节点上,避免了数据倾斜问题。这种均匀分布使得每个节点负载均衡,有效提升了整个集群的性能和处理效率,确保系统能够高效稳定地运行。
另外,Redis集群支持读写分离。主节点负责处理写操作,从节点则承担读操作,这样可以分散读请求,减轻主节点的负担,提高系统的并发处理能力。对于读操作频繁的应用场景,这种特性能够显著提升系统的响应速度和性能。
最后,Redis集群的简易性也值得一提。它提供了简单直观的操作接口,开发人员可以轻松地进行集群的搭建、管理和维护。这降低了技术门槛,节省了开发和运维成本,让更多企业能够快速应用Redis集群技术。
Redis集群凭借其高可扩展性、容错能力、数据均匀分布、读写分离以及简易性等特性,为企业提供了一个高效、稳定、可靠的数据存储和处理解决方案,助力企业在数字化浪潮中快速发展。
- Redis 与 Groovy 助力开发定时任务功能的方法
- MySQL与Java助力开发简易在线点餐系统的方法
- MySQL 与 Ruby 实现简单数据查询分析功能的方法
- Redis 与 TypeScript 实现缓存穿透防御功能的方法
- Redis 与 Shell 脚本实现备份恢复功能的方法
- 存储过程中如何使用 MySQL IF ELSE 语句
- Redis与Perl 6助力分布式文件同步功能开发之道
- MySQL与Java实现简单聊天室功能的方法
- 未给出列名和值时运行 INSERT INTO 语句 MySQL 返回什么
- Python在MySQL中编写自定义函数的方法
- MySQL与C++ 实现简单批量重命名功能的开发方法
- 查询检查MySQL表列字符集的方法
- MySQL 中用 JavaScript 编写自定义存储过程与函数的方法
- MySQL 与 JavaScript 实现简单地图标记功能的方法
- Redis 与 Dart 助力开发缓存穿透防御功能的方法